# Hedera EVM Setup Guide for Sentinel Protocol

This guide walks you through setting up the Sentinel Protocol to work with Hedera's EVM-compatible network.

## What is Hedera EVM?

Hedera is a public distributed ledger that supports EVM-compatible smart contracts through its JSON-RPC relay service. This allows you to use familiar Ethereum tools (MetaMask, Web3.js, Ethers.js) while benefiting from Hedera's:

- ⚡ High throughput (10,000+ TPS)
- 💰 Low, predictable fees
- 🔒 Enterprise-grade security
- 🌍 Carbon-negative network

## Network Information

### Hedera Testnet
- **Chain ID**: 296 (0x128)
- **RPC URL**: https://testnet.hashio.io/api
- **Explorer**: https://hashscan.io/testnet
- **Faucet**: Available at Hedera Portal
- **Currency**: HBAR (test)

### Hedera Mainnet
- **Chain ID**: 295 (0x127)
- **RPC URL**: https://mainnet.hashio.io/api
- **Explorer**: https://hashscan.io/mainnet
- **Currency**: HBAR

## Adding Hedera to MetaMask

The frontend automatically prompts users to add the Hedera network, but you can also add it manually:

1. Open MetaMask
2. Click on the network dropdown
3. Click "Add Network"
4. Enter the following details:

**For Testnet:**
- Network Name: `Hedera Testnet`
- RPC URL: `https://testnet.hashio.io/api`
- Chain ID: `296`
- Currency Symbol: `HBAR`
- Block Explorer: `https://hashscan.io/testnet`

**For Mainnet:**
- Network Name: `Hedera Mainnet`
- RPC URL: `https://mainnet.hashio.io/api`
- Chain ID: `295`
- Currency Symbol: `HBAR`
- Block Explorer: `https://hashscan.io/mainnet`

## Deploying Smart Contracts

### Prerequisites
- Solidity compiler (solc)
- Hardhat or Foundry (optional, for easier deployment)
- HBAR in your wallet for gas fees

### Using Remix IDE

1. Go to [Remix IDE](https://remix.ethereum.org/)
2. Load your contract (`TokenReputationContract.sol`)
3. Compile the contract
4. Go to "Deploy & Run Transactions"
5. Select "Injected Provider - MetaMask"
6. Ensure MetaMask is on Hedera network
7. Deploy the contract
8. Copy the contract address
9. Update your `.env` files with the contract address

### Using Hardhat

```javascript
// hardhat.config.js
module.exports = {
networks: {
hederaTestnet: {
url: "https://testnet.hashio.io/api",
chainId: 296,
accounts: [process.env.PRIVATE_KEY]
}
}
};
```

Deploy:
```bash
npx hardhat run scripts/deploy.js --network hederaTestnet
```

## Troubleshooting

### Connection Issues

**Problem**: Cannot connect to Hedera network

**Solutions**:
- Check RPC URL is correct
- Verify internet connection
- Try alternative RPC endpoints if available
- Check if Hedera network is operational at [status.hedera.com](https://status.hedera.com/)

### Transaction Failures

**Problem**: Transactions fail or revert

**Solutions**:
- Ensure wallet has sufficient HBAR for gas
- Check that contract address is correct
- Verify private key matches owner address
- Check gas limit is sufficient
- Review contract function parameters

### Wrong Network

**Problem**: MetaMask is on wrong network

**Solutions**:
- Use the frontend's automatic network switching
- Manually switch in MetaMask
- Check NEXT_PUBLIC_HEDERA_CHAIN_ID matches network

### API Rate Limiting

**Problem**: API requests being rate limited

**Solutions**:
- Increase API_DELAY in `.env`
- Upgrade to paid API tier
- Implement caching for repeated requests

## Cost Estimation

### Testnet
- **All operations are FREE** - use test HBAR from faucet

### Mainnet
- **Transactions**: ~$0.01-0.05 per transaction
- **Contract Deployment**: ~$1-5 depending on contract size
- **Contract Interactions**: ~$0.01-0.10 per function call

Note: Hedera fees are significantly lower than Ethereum mainnet!

## Security Best Practices

1. **Never commit `.env` files** - they contain sensitive data
2. **Use different wallets for testnet and mainnet**
3. **Keep minimal funds in hot wallets**
4. **Regularly rotate API keys**
5. **Use environment-specific configuration files**
6. **Validate all inputs before sending transactions**
7. **Test thoroughly on testnet before mainnet deployment**
